服务器关机,服务器关机命令 shutdown now

老青蛙82024-11-28 17:22:30

服务器关机,服务器关机命令 shutdown now

在服务器管理中,正确地关闭服务器是一项重要的任务。本文将详细探讨服务器关机的相关知识,特别是服务器关机命令 `shutdown now` 的使用。

一、服务器关机的重要性

服务器作为企业和组织的核心基础设施,承载着各种关键业务和数据。因此,正确地关闭服务器对于维护系统的稳定性、数据的安全性以及避免潜在的硬件损坏至关重要。

服务器关机的主要原因包括:

  • 进行系统维护和升级:在对服务器进行软件更新、硬件维护或配置更改时,需要先关闭服务器,以确保操作的安全性和正确性。
  • 节省能源:当服务器在非工作时间或不需要运行时,关闭服务器可以节省能源成本。
  • 应对紧急情况:如服务器出现故障、遭受攻击或存在安全隐患时,及时关闭服务器可以防止问题进一步扩大。

总之,服务器关机是服务器管理中的一个重要环节,需要谨慎操作,以确保服务器的正常运行和数据的安全。

二、服务器关机的方法

服务器关机的方法有多种,常见的包括通过操作系统的图形界面进行关机、使用命令行工具进行关机以及通过远程管理工具进行关机。下面将重点介绍使用命令行工具进行服务器关机的方法。

在 Linux 系统中,常用的服务器关机命令是 `shutdown`。`shutdown` 命令可以用于安全地关闭服务器,并可以设置关机的时间、消息等参数。下面是 `shutdown` 命令的基本语法:

shutdown [选项] [时间] [警告信息]

其中,选项包括:

  • `-h`:表示关机后关闭电源。
  • `-r`:表示关机后重新启动服务器。
  • `-k`:表示发送警告信息,但并不真正关机。

时间参数可以是以下几种形式:

  • `now`:表示立即关机。
  • `+m`:表示在 m 分钟后关机。
  • `hh:mm`:表示在指定的时间(小时:分钟)关机。

警告信息是可选的,用于在关机前向所有登录用户发送一条提示信息。

例如,要立即关闭服务器并关闭电源,可以使用以下命令:

shutdown -h now

要在 30 分钟后关闭服务器并发送一条警告信息“服务器将在 30 分钟后关闭,请保存好您的工作”,可以使用以下命令:

shutdown -h +30 "服务器将在 30 分钟后关闭,请保存好您的工作"

在 Windows 系统中,也可以使用命令行工具来关闭服务器。常用的命令是 `shutdown.exe`。`shutdown.exe` 命令的基本语法如下:

shutdown [选项]

其中,选项包括:

  • `/s`:表示关闭计算机。
  • `/r`:表示重新启动计算机。
  • `/l`:表示注销当前用户。
  • `/t xx`:表示设置关机的超时时间为 xx 秒。

例如,要立即关闭服务器,可以使用以下命令:

shutdown /s

要在 60 秒后关闭服务器,可以使用以下命令:

shutdown /s /t 60

总之,不同的操作系统有不同的服务器关机方法,管理员需要根据实际情况选择合适的方法进行操作。

三、服务器关机命令 shutdown now 的详细解释

`shutdown now` 是一个常用的服务器关机命令,它在 Linux 系统中用于立即关闭服务器。下面将对 `shutdown now` 命令进行详细解释。

`shutdown now` 命令的实际执行过程如下:

  1. 发送警告信息:`shutdown` 命令会向所有登录用户发送一条警告信息,告知服务器即将关闭。这个警告信息可以在命令中通过参数指定,也可以使用系统默认的警告信息。
  2. 杀死进程:在发送警告信息后,`shutdown` 命令会逐步杀死正在运行的进程,以确保服务器能够安全地关闭。这个过程可能需要一些时间,具体时间取决于服务器上正在运行的进程数量和复杂度。
  3. 卸载文件系统:在杀死进程后,`shutdown` 命令会卸载服务器上的文件系统,以确保数据的完整性。
  4. 关闭系统:在完成上述步骤后,`shutdown` 命令会最终关闭服务器的电源,使服务器完全停止运行。

需要注意的是,`shutdown now` 命令是一个强制关机命令,它会立即关闭服务器,而不会等待正在运行的进程完成或用户保存数据。因此,在使用 `shutdown now` 命令时,需要确保服务器上没有正在进行的重要操作,并且已经通知了所有用户保存好他们的工作。

此外,`shutdown now` 命令需要管理员权限才能执行。如果您没有管理员权限,将无法使用该命令关闭服务器。

四、服务器关机的注意事项

在进行服务器关机操作时,需要注意以下几点:

  • 提前通知用户:在关闭服务器之前,应该提前通知所有可能受到影响的用户,让他们保存好自己的工作并退出系统。
  • 检查服务器状态:在关闭服务器之前,应该检查服务器的状态,确保没有正在进行的重要任务或进程。如果有,应该等待这些任务或进程完成后再进行关机操作。
  • 备份数据:在关闭服务器之前,应该备份重要的数据,以防止数据丢失。
  • 按照正确的顺序关闭服务器:在关闭服务器时,应该按照正确的顺序进行操作,先关闭应用程序和服务,然后再关闭操作系统。
  • 等待服务器完全关闭:在执行关机命令后,应该等待服务器完全关闭后再进行其他操作。如果服务器没有完全关闭,可能会导致数据丢失或系统损坏。

总之,服务器关机是一项重要的操作,需要谨慎对待。只有在确保服务器安全的情况下,才能进行关机操作。

五、结论

服务器关机是服务器管理中的一个重要环节,正确地关闭服务器可以确保系统的稳定性、数据的安全性以及避免潜在的硬件损坏。本文介绍了服务器关机的重要性、方法以及服务器关机命令 `shutdown now` 的详细解释和使用注意事项。希望本文对您有所帮助,让您能够更好地管理服务器。

收藏
点赞
本文转载自互联网,具体来源未知,或在文章中已说明来源,若有权利人发现,请联系我们更正。本站尊重原创,转载文章仅为传递更多信息之目的,并不意味着赞同其观点或证实其内容的真实性。如其他媒体、网站或个人从本网站转载使用,请保留本站注明的文章来源,并自负版权等法律责任。如有关于文章内容的疑问或投诉,请及时联系我们。我们转载此文的目的在于传递更多信息,同时也希望找到原作者,感谢各位读者的支持!

本文链接:https://7301.cn/idc/8739.html

网友评论

猜你喜欢
热门排行
热评文章